Each episode—and subsequent DVD release—focused on a singular, culturally definitive album. The brilliance of the series lay in its access. Producers brought original artists, engineers, and producers back into the recording studio. Sitting in front of the mixing console, these creators pushed up the faders on the original multi-track master tapes, isolating specific instruments, vocal takes, and hidden studio idiosyncrasies.
